Boban Markovic had another chance to celebrate in 2000, the Orkestar again winning the prize of "Best Band" in Guca. In Hungary there was hardly a festival that did not invite them.
This CD, as seen from the title, mirrors Boban's 'Millennium': the hit songs, numbers fine-tuned during the year, followed by typical Serbian music such as "Zaidi" and the "Oj, Borije". The album underlines his compositional abilities while his virtuoso trumpet solos are still
unique!
